Several factors are driving the growth of the adhesive tapes market. The burgeoning automotive industry, with its increasing demand for lightweight and fuel-efficient vehicles, is a significant contributor. Adhesive tapes are increasingly replacing traditional mechanical fasteners, leading to weight reduction and improved fuel economy. Similarly, the electronics sector's relentless pursuit of miniaturization and improved device performance relies heavily on advanced adhesive tapes for bonding, sealing, and insulation. The construction industry also plays a crucial role, utilizing adhesive tapes for a multitude of applications, from sealing windows and doors to bonding various building materials. Furthermore, the growth of e-commerce has significantly increased the demand for packaging tapes, driving substantial market expansion. The healthcare sector also utilizes adhesive tapes extensively, with applications ranging from wound care to medical device manufacturing. Finally, the development of innovative adhesive technologies, such as pressure-sensitive adhesives (PSAs) with improved adhesion, durability, and temperature resistance, is further propelling market growth. These advancements allow for the creation of tapes suitable for even the most demanding applications.
Despite the positive growth trajectory, the adhesive tapes market faces several challenges. Fluctuations in raw material prices, particularly for polymers and adhesives, can significantly impact production costs and profitability. The market is also subject to intense competition, with numerous established players and emerging manufacturers vying for market share. Maintaining a competitive edge requires continuous innovation and investment in research and development. Furthermore, environmental concerns surrounding the disposal of adhesive tapes and the use of certain chemicals in their production are emerging as significant challenges. Meeting increasingly stringent environmental regulations necessitates the development of eco-friendly and sustainable adhesive tape solutions. Finally, economic downturns can negatively affect demand, particularly in sectors heavily reliant on construction and manufacturing. The market's success will hinge on manufacturers' ability to navigate these challenges through effective cost management, strategic partnerships, and a commitment to sustainability.
Asia-Pacific: This region is projected to dominate the market due to rapid industrialization, expanding manufacturing sectors (particularly in electronics and automotive), and a growing consumer base. China, Japan, and South Korea are key contributors to this growth.
North America: Significant demand from the automotive, construction, and healthcare sectors, coupled with a strong technological base and a focus on innovation, positions North America as a major market.
Europe: While growth may be slower compared to Asia-Pacific, Europe's strong focus on sustainability and the adoption of eco-friendly adhesive technologies will drive market growth in this region.
High-Performance Tapes: This segment is experiencing rapid expansion due to its increasing application in demanding industries, such as aerospace, electronics, and automotive, where high performance and reliability are essential.
Packaging Tapes: This segment remains a significant portion of the market due to the substantial growth of e-commerce and the increasing demand for efficient and secure packaging solutions.
Medical Tapes: This niche market demonstrates consistent growth driven by advancements in medical technology and the growing demand for advanced wound care products.
